Default Panther restoration

I am sure this Panther will add a lot to the already excellent display in the CWM gallery, and looks like an excellent job was done on it.There is a small story on it on the internet which says it was in a VE day display in Toronto at the end of the war, and then was moved to CFB Borden. Its original unit is unknown apparently,as no markings survived .Possibly some archival photos may exist when it was captured,but this would take some looking.Again, I really hope the other Ontario Panther is not forgotten, as this could be restored,possibly by another museum/volunteers.
